Join us for this unique career exploration camp into the world of manufacturing! 

High school students in partnership with Component Bar Products in O'Fallon will design and build a product, experiencing the start-to-finish satisfaction of creating something you can show off with pride.  In the process, you will learn how to do CAD design and operate various kinds of manufacturing machinery under the close supervision of expert manufacturing trainers.

Middle school students will work in teams and learn how to collaborate together to work on robotic challenges using NXT Mindstorm kits and the newest technology - EV3 Lego® Kits.

Both groups will tour local manufacturing facilities to learn what types of jobs exist, what skills and training are required, and how those businesses are developed.  You will have the opportunity to hear directly from local manufacturing company owners how they started their businesses, applying basic entrepreneurship principles to understand how a single product idea becomes a business.

Whether you aspire to work in manufacturing or medicine, law or any other field, having a basic understanding of how things are made and how businesses develop will make you more appreciative of the world around you and the tools you will use in your life.

Tshirts and transporation provided.
